Breaking Chains Street Ministry Breaking Chains serves as a homeless outreach ministry in Wichita, KS.

The name Breaking Chains symbolizes the hope in Christ to release the hold of the shackles that bind us. The individuals and families whom the ministry serves are all affected by different circumstances and life choices. The hope is that through the visible love of ministry workers and the knowledge of God’s unconditional love, chains will be broken, lives will be changed for Christ and hope will be restored.

Let's pray... Almighty and most merciful God, we remember before you all poor and neglected persons whom it would be easy for us to forget: the homeless and the destitute, the old and the sick, and all who have none to care for them. Help us to heal those who are broken in body or spirit, and to turn their sorrow into joy. In the name of Jesus Christ our Lord... Amen!

Let's Pray... Lord Jesus, teach us to see who you see. Help us to be a people who can’t walk past without stopping, and staying, to meet a need, or listen to a story.

Make us always ready to comfort, and to pray with those on our streets. Keep us open to what you are asking us to do for each one. Give us your courage to look people in the eye, and your love to reach out in compassion.

Grant us your peace so that we know we are in your hands, and doing your will as we step beyond what feels comfortable and safe.
May your perfect love for a stranger, cast out fear and leave us ready to be your hands and feet to them today. Amen!
